Two of the most used metric system units are meters (m) and millimeters (mm). They both measure length, but differ in magnitude. According to the treaty signed by the International System of Units (SI) in 1959, 1,000 millimeters equal 1 meter.
As we have already established, the millimeter is only 0.001 of a meter. This is also indicated by its prefix ‘milli’, which comes from Latin and means ‘1/1,000 of’. In order to convert units adopted by the metric system, you need to calculate multiples of 10. One way for you to transform millimeters to meters is simply move the decimal point three places to the left. You’ll receive the same result if you go by this formula: mm / 1,000 = m.

To convert millimeters to meters, multiply the millimeter value by 0.001 or divide by 1000. For example, to convert 100 millimeters to meters, you can use the following formula: m = mm * 0.001. multiply 100 by 0.001: m = 100 * 0.001 = 0.1 m. Therefore, 100 millimeters equal to 0.1 meter.
